filt
是一个 Unix/Linux 命令行工具,用于过滤文本
日志分析:在处理大量日志文件时,可以使用 filt
来提取特定关键字或模式的日志行。这有助于分析错误、性能问题或其他重要信息。
示例:
cat logfile.txt | filt "ERROR" > error_log.txt
数据清洗:在处理原始数据时,可以使用 filt
来删除不需要的行或列。这有助于准备数据以供进一步分析或可视化。
示例:
cat data.csv | filt -v ",NA" > cleaned_data.csv
代码审查:在审查代码时,可以使用 filt
来查找特定类型的问题,如未使用的变量、缺少注释等。
示例:
grep -r "TODO" src/ | filt -v "DONE" > todo_list.txt
配置文件处理:在处理配置文件时,可以使用 filt
来提取或修改特定设置。
示例:
cat config.ini | filt "setting=" > settings.txt
文本替换:在处理文本文件时,可以使用 filt
结合 sed
命令来替换特定文本。
示例:
cat input.txt | filt "old_text" | sed "s/old_text/new_text/g" > output.txt
数据转换:在处理数据时,可以使用 filt
结合其他命令行工具(如 awk
、sort
等)来转换数据格式。
示例:
cat data.txt | filt -v "header" | awk '{print $2, $1}' | sort > sorted_data.txt
这些只是 filt
在实际项目中的一些成功应用案例。实际上,filt
可以与其他命令行工具结合使用,以满足各种文本处理需求。